One post, every platform,
zero rewriting
From single idea to published-everywhere in three steps. Here's exactly what happens under the hood.
Write once in the Composer
One canvas. Your voice. No platform switching.
Draft your idea in plain language — full sentences, a rough outline, or a single thought.
Attach media if you have it; skip if you don't. We render the preview either way.
Pick a source platform if the draft leans into its conventions (X-style hook, IG caption, etc.) — otherwise leave it on Generic.
AI adapts for every platform
Native tone, native length, native hashtag culture — per channel.
Character-limit aware: X truncates and restructures, Facebook expands the context, Instagram adds the hook line.
Tone-matched: your brand profile (voice, pillars, audience) is injected into every generation.
Side-by-side live previews — edit any variant inline, and the character counter updates in real time.
Schedule, publish, measure
One screen to hit post on every channel.
Set per-platform schedule times, or hit Schedule All for the same slot.
Cron job fires on the minute — posts go live to each platform's API and statuses flip to Published.
Analytics roll back up: engagement by variant, best-performing platform per post, and weekly trends.
Built for three platforms, deeply
Not a generalist tool with a dropdown — each integration is tuned to the platform's actual rules.
X (Twitter)
280-char thread-aware splitting, hook-first restructuring, hashtag discipline (2 max), CTA tail.
Hook line + break + context, hashtag block pushed to end, captions optimized for 125-char preview.
Long-form context expansion, conversational tone, question prompts that drive comments.
Why the AI layer matters
Other tools let you copy-paste into ChatGPT. We built the adaptation engine natively — so every feature compounds.
AI-first, not AI-bolted
Adaptation is the product. The composer, the calendar, and the analytics all exist to serve the AI engine — which means every feature compounds on platform-native tone matching.
Brand voice, not generic AI
Your onboarding captures niche, tone, pillars, and audience pain points. Every generation is grounded in that profile — so posts sound like you, not like a chatbot.
Structural awareness
We don't just trim to 280 chars. We restructure the hook, move the CTA, relocate hashtags, and reorder beats so each version reads like it was written for that platform.
One screen, every surface
Composer, previews, schedule pickers, and publishing state all live on a single page. You never lose context switching between platforms or tabs.
Frequently asked
Do I need to connect all three platforms on day one?
No. Connect one and still use the composer + AI adaptation. Preview cards appear only for the platforms you've connected; others show a Connect prompt.
Can I edit the AI output?
Yes — every variant is inline-editable. Click the pencil on any preview card, type your changes, and the character count updates live.
Will the AI learn my voice over time?
The brand profile you set during onboarding is loaded on every generation. You can revise it anytime — AI outputs pick up the changes immediately.
What if a scheduled post fails to publish?
We retry with exponential backoff and flag the post in red on the calendar with the error message. You can fix token/connection issues and retry manually.
Try it for yourself
Join early access and write your first adapted post in under two minutes.

